Hey everyone. So I am cleaning out my parent's old stuff now, and have come across these five vintage baseball pennants. (see pictures)
Trying to determine if any of these are rare / high value. I have done some online research, but not an expert so getting some conflicting information. San Francisco Giants: I have only seen two pictures of this design online. value was $85 for one and $150 for other. Baltimore Orioles: Lots of examples with bird batting, but only found one example with the bird pitching like this, and with the stadium. that one was $140ish. Kansas City Athletics: I cannot find any pictures or examples of this design online. Plenty with a batting elephant, but the elephant is on all fours with bat in his trunk, no examples anthropomorphized in uniform. Pittsburgh Pirates: This one seems common, but still seeing values from $25 to $100, which is a wide range. New York Yankees: Only found one example of this style, bat and crown, and it was on an auctioneers site that required signing up to get more information. I know the Yankees are popular, so if unusual this would be worth something. I figured a specialty forum would have people in the know, who could tell me some more information on these.
